Hindustan Zinc has strengthened its longstanding association with Tata Steel to expand the integration of EcoZen, its low-carbon zinc solution into sustainable steel manufacturing. The collaboration reflects both companies’ shared commitment to embedding climate considerations into core industrial processes and procurement strategies. EcoZen, Asia’s first low-carbon zinc, is produced using renewable energy and has a verified carbon footprint of less than 1 tonne of Carbon Dioxide equivalent per tonne of zinc - around 75% lower than the global industry average. By significantly reducing emissions at the raw material stage, EcoZen enables downstream industries to meaningfully lower value-chain emissions and advance their decarbonisation goals.

Hindustan Zinc has been a trusted strategic partner to Tata Steel for over two decades.
